Role Overview
As a Senior Data Engineer, you will design, build, and operate data pipelines and finance data products that power critical financial systems. You will work closely with finance and engineering stakeholders to improve data quality, reliability, and scalability across the data platform.

This role requires strong hands on data engineering expertise, ownership mindset, and the ability to operate in a complex, enterprise scale environment.

Key Responsibilities
Design, develop, and operate ETL and ELT pipelines delivering finance data products for Accounting, Finance, Payments, and Tax teams.
Build and maintain data models, transformations, and tests using DBT.
Develop and operate AWS based data jobs using AWS Glue and AWS Lambda.
Orchestrate data workflows and schedules using Apache Airflow.
Ensure high standards of data quality, validation, observability, and platform reliability.
Collaborate directly with finance stakeholders to gather requirements and deliver production ready data solutions.
Optimize SQL queries and manage performance of analytical and relational datasets.
Contribute to the continuous evolution of the finance data platform, improving scalability, maintainability, and engineering standards.

Required Qualifications
Senior level experience building and operating data platforms and pipelines, ideally 5+ years.
Strong Python expertise focused on data processing, ETL patterns, and performance optimization.
Hands on experience with AWS Glue and AWS Lambda for data ingestion and processing.
Strong experience using DBT for transformations, testing, and data modeling.
Advanced SQL skills and experience working with analytical and relational databases.
Experience designing and operating ETL pipelines and modern data platform patterns.
Hands on experience with Apache Airflow for orchestration and workflow management.
Proven experience implementing data quality checks, testing strategies, and monitoring.
Ability to collaborate effectively with non technical stakeholders in finance, accounting, payments, or tax domains.
